Scott went to the AIS School in New Delhi in 1968 because his Uncle Bob invited him to live with him and his family in India. That experience changed Scott’s life forever. Here are some shots of the school’s geodesic dome designed by Buckminster Fuller. A few short years later Scott would be studying architecture under Buckminster Fuller at S.I.U.in Carbondale, Illinois 300 miles from Chicago. Decades later Scott would buy a home on Deer Isle, Maine only to discover a couple of years after that Bucky had been a prominent summer resident there, too, and his relatives still live on the island. Synchronicity and the ever widening circles at play…
